Ukrzaliznytsia is like a micro-model of Ukraine.
State within a state They have their own infrastructure. their hospitals. own productions. It even has its own army - paramilitary guards. This is a very specific place and you need to be prepared for it. Looking at this company you immediately understand why our reforms are not taking place so quickly.
